Raph Koster Announces New Studio Playable Worlds, New MMO Already In Development October 5, 2019 Marc Marasigan Comments A few days ago, Ultima Online and Star Wars Galaxies Lead Designer Raph Koster announced his new game development studio called Playable Worlds. A pioneer of massively multiplayer online games, Koster is regarded as one of the video game industry's foremost authorities on game design.
